Federal Reserve Governor Lisa Cook has announced she is not resigning, despite allegations of mortgage fraud made by the Federal Housing leader on X.
If Lisa Cook is forced off the Fed's governing board, it would provide President Donald Trump an opportunity to appoint a loyalist.
Trump on social media called on her to resign over an accusation from one his officials that she committed mortgage fraud.
US president Donald Trump has called for Lisa Cook, a governor of the Federal Reserve, to resign. Trump posted on social media on August 20: “Cook must resign, now!!!”.
